--- Begin Message ---
Package: dolphin
Version: 4:25.04.3-1
Severity: normal
X-Debbugs-Cc: klipo89@gmail.com
Dear Maintainer,
When running Dolphin on a multi-monitor Wayland setup with a rotated monitor
and vertical offset,
right-click context menus appear centered in the window instead of at the
cursor location.
This issue did not occur before the recent update to version 4:25.04.3-1.
Running Dolphin with `QT_QPA_PLATFORM=xcb` (XWayland) fixes the problem,
indicating a
Wayland-specific popup positioning bug in the new version.
Expected behavior: context menus should appear at the cursor position
regardless of monitor layout.
Steps to reproduce:
- Use a multi-monitor setup with one monitor to the left rotated and offset
vertically (see attached kscreen-doctor output).
- Run Dolphin natively on Wayland.
- Right-click inside Dolphin’s window in the affected monitor’s upper right
quadrant.
Outcome: Context menu appears centered instead of near the cursor.
Please investigate and fix the Wayland popup positioning issue in Dolphin or
underlying Qt/Plasma libraries.
Output: 1 HDMI-A-1
enabled
connected
priority 2
HDMI
Modes: 1:1920x1080@60*! 2:1920x1080@60 3:1920x1080@60
4:1920x1080@50 5:1600x900@60 6:1280x1024@75 7:1280x1024@60 8:1152x864@75
9:1280x720@75 10:1280x720@60 11:1280x720@60 12:1280x720@60 13:1280x720@50
14:1024x768@75 15:1024x768@60 16:800x600@75 17:800x600@60 18:720x576@50
19:720x480@60 20:720x480@60 21:720x480@60 22:720x480@60 23:720x480@60
24:640x480@75 25:640x480@60 26:640x480@60 27:640x480@60 28:720x400@70
Geometry: 0,0 1080x1920
Scale: 1
Rotation: 2
Overscan: 0
Vrr: incapable
RgbRange: Full
HDR: incapable
Wide Color Gamut: incapable
ICC profile: /home/jen/Documents/ICC Profiles/P2222H.icm
Color profile source: ICC
Color power preference: prefer accuracy
Brightness control: supported, set to 100% and dimming to 100%
Output: 2 DP-1
enabled
connected
priority 1
DisplayPort
Modes: 29:2560x1440@60! 30:2560x1440@75* 31:1920x1080@75
32:1920x1080@60 33:1920x1080@60 34:1920x1080@60 35:1920x1080@50
36:1600x900@60 37:1280x1024@75 38:1280x1024@60 39:1152x864@75
40:1280x720@60 41:1280x720@60 42:1280x720@50 43:1024x768@75 44:1024x768@60
45:800x600@75 46:800x600@60 47:720x576@50 48:720x480@60 49:720x480@60
50:720x480@60 51:720x480@60 52:640x480@75 53:640x480@60 54:640x480@60
55:640x480@60 56:720x400@70
Geometry: 1080,342 2560x1440
Scale: 1
Rotation: 1
Overscan: 0
Vrr: Never
RgbRange: Full
HDR: incapable
Wide Color Gamut: incapable
ICC profile: /home/jen/Documents/ICC Profiles/SE2723DS.icm
Color profile source: ICC
Color power preference: prefer accuracy
Brightness control: supported, set to 100% and dimming to 100%
Thanks.
-- System Information:
Debian Release: 13.0
APT prefers testing-security
APT policy: (500, 'testing-security'), (500, 'testing'), (1, 'experimental'), (1, 'unstable')
Architecture: amd64 (x86_64)
Kernel: Linux 6.16-rc7-amd64 (SMP w/16 CPU threads; PREEMPT)
Locale: LANG=en_US.UTF-8, LC_CTYPE=en_US.UTF-8 (charmap=UTF-8), LANGUAGE not set
Shell: /bin/sh linked to /usr/bin/dash
Init: systemd (via /run/systemd/system)
LSM: AppArmor: enabled
Versions of packages dolphin depends on:
ii baloo6 6.13.0-1
ii dolphin-data 4:25.04.3-1
ii kio6 6.13.0-6
ii libc6 2.41-11
ii libdolphinvcs6 4:25.04.3-1
ii libkf6baloo6 6.13.0-1
ii libkf6baloowidgets6 4:25.04.0-1
ii libkf6bookmarks6 6.13.0-1
ii libkf6bookmarkswidgets6 6.13.0-1
ii libkf6codecs6 6.13.0-1
ii libkf6colorscheme6 6.13.0-1
ii libkf6completion6 6.13.0-1
ii libkf6configcore6 6.13.0-2
ii libkf6configgui6 6.13.0-2
ii libkf6configwidgets6 6.13.0-1
ii libkf6coreaddons6 6.13.0-1
ii libkf6crash6 6.13.0-1
ii libkf6dbusaddons6 6.13.0-1
ii libkf6filemetadata3 6.13.0-1
ii libkf6guiaddons6 6.13.0-1
ii libkf6i18n6 6.13.0-1
ii libkf6iconthemes6 6.13.0-2
ii libkf6jobwidgets6 6.13.0-1
ii libkf6kcmutils6 6.13.0-2
ii libkf6kcmutilscore6 6.13.0-2
ii libkf6kiocore6 6.13.0-6
ii libkf6kiofilewidgets6 6.13.0-6
ii libkf6kiogui6 6.13.0-6
ii libkf6kiowidgets6 6.13.0-6
ii libkf6newstuffwidgets6 6.13.0-1
ii libkf6notifications6 6.13.0-1
ii libkf6parts6 6.13.0-1
ii libkf6service-bin 6.13.0-1
ii libkf6service6 6.13.0-1
ii libkf6solid6 6.13.0-1
ii libkf6textwidgets6 6.13.0-1
ii libkf6userfeedbackcore6 6.13.0-1
ii libkf6userfeedbackwidgets6 6.13.0-1
ii libkf6widgetsaddons6 6.13.0-1
ii libkf6windowsystem6 6.13.0-2
ii libkf6xmlgui6 6.13.0-1
ii libpackagekitqt6-1 1.1.2-1+b1
ii libphonon4qt6-4t64 4:4.12.0-5
ii libqt6core6t64 [qt6-base-private-abi] 6.8.2+dfsg-9
ii libqt6dbus6 6.8.2+dfsg-9
ii libqt6gui6 6.8.2+dfsg-9
ii libqt6widgets6 6.8.2+dfsg-9
ii libqt6xml6 6.8.2+dfsg-9
ii libstdc++6 15.1.0-8
ii phonon4qt6 4:4.12.0-5
Versions of packages dolphin recommends:
ii dolphin-doc 4:25.04.3-1
ii dolphin-plugins 4:25.04.0-1
ii ffmpegthumbs 4:25.04.0-2
ii kdegraphics-thumbnailers 4:25.04.0-1
ii kdenetwork-filesharing 4:25.04.3-1
ii kimageformat6-plugins 6.13.0-2
ii kio-extras 4:25.04.3-1
ii qt6-image-formats-plugins 6.8.2-4
Versions of packages dolphin suggests:
pn kio-admin <none>
-- no debconf information
--- End Message ---